Summary
Xcode Cloud is Apple's continuous integration and delivery service. As a Web Engineer on the team, you will design and build the interfaces that developers around the world rely on to manage builds, run tests in parallel, distribute to testers, and act on feedback as they ship apps for iOS, iPadOS, macOS, watchOS, tvOS, and visionOS.
Description
You will design and build Xcode Cloud's web experience alongside our Human Interface designers and server engineers, treating performance, security, privacy, and accessibility as core requirements throughout. Your decisions shape the daily workflow of developers shipping apps for Apple’s platforms.

Minimum Qualifications
- 3 years of professional experience building large-scale web applications with HTML, CSS, and JavaScript or TypeScript
- A strong grasp of web fundamentals, including accessibility and performance
- Experience with automated testing, code review, and continuous delivery
- Experience communicating with customers and collaborating across design and engineering teams
- Experience working in a multi-discipline teams
- Bachelor in Computer Science or related industry experience
- Experience with a component-based UI framework such as React
- Familiarity with monorepo tooling such as Turborepo, Nx
- Experience integrating web service APIs
- Exposure to iOS or macOS development with Swift, Objective-C, or C/C++
- Fluency with AI assistants and agentic coding workflows
- Enthusiasm for great design
